Output d9e35d621a3d6b7718d8a1830c343cfac5b8371fd340a8d1149804147930600b:2

value
672740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dcaca77db6706b35272f948750224dfe688d9b6 OP_EQUAL
address
2MuxkX1Fh9jBR2tzQ2Cau6u6sbKdVgX4egU
transaction
d9e35d621a3d6b7718d8a1830c343cfac5b8371fd340a8d1149804147930600b
confirmations
84010
spent
true